How to Land a Job in a Leading C&F Firm with Precision

Before applying, learn what Clearing and Forwarding (C&F) firms do. Know the basics of customs clearance, shipping documentation, import/export regulations, and freight forwarding. This knowledge helps you speak the language and show genuine interest.

2. Identify Key Skills Required

C&F roles often demand skills such as:

  • Knowledge of customs laws and procedures

  • Documentation management (Bills of Lading, Invoices, Packing Lists)

  • Communication skills to liaise with customs officials, shipping lines, and clients

  • Problem-solving and attention to detail

  • Basic computer skills, especially MS Office and logistics software

Highlight these in your CV and during interviews.

3. Build Relevant Qualifications

Having certifications or diplomas related to logistics, supply chain management, or international trade can significantly boost your profile. Look for courses from reputed institutes or online platforms.

4. Prepare a Targeted CV and Cover Letter

Tailor your CV specifically for C&F jobs:

  • Include relevant education, internships, or experiences in logistics or shipping

  • Highlight achievements like handling documentation or coordinating shipments

  • Keep it clear, concise, and error-free

In your cover letter, express enthusiasm for the C&F industry and mention why you want to work at that particular firm.

5. Leverage Networking

Many C&F firms value personal recommendations. Attend industry events, seminars, or job fairs. Connect with current or former employees on LinkedIn. Join groups related to logistics and supply chain in Bangladesh or your region.

6. Apply Through the Right Channels

Leading C&F firms usually post vacancies on:

  • Their official websites

  • Job portals like BDJobs

  • Professional networks

Apply promptly and follow instructions carefully.

7. Prepare Thoroughly for Interviews

Expect questions on:

  • Your understanding of customs clearance and forwarding

  • How you handle documentation and compliance

  • Problem-solving in shipment delays or discrepancies

  • Communication skills and teamwork

Prepare examples from your past experiences to showcase these.

8. Demonstrate Reliability and Integrity

C&F firms deal with sensitive shipments and legal documentation. Emphasize your trustworthiness, accuracy, and ability to work under pressure.

9. Consider Internships or Entry-Level Roles

If you’re new to the industry, internships or junior roles provide valuable experience. They can lead to permanent positions in leading firms.

10. Keep Learning and Updating Skills

Trade regulations and logistics technologies evolve. Stay updated through courses, webinars, and industry news to remain competitive.


Final Thought

Landing a job in a top C&F firm takes preparation, focus, and persistence. By understanding the industry, tailoring your approach, and showing professionalism, you can increase your chances of success with precision.
